How the Steps to Miles Calculator Works
The calculator works by taking your total number of steps and your stride length in feet. Using the simple formula: Miles=Steps×Stride Length5280\text{Miles} = \frac{\text{Steps} \times \text{Stride Length}}{5280}Miles=5280Steps×Stride Length
It converts your walking activity into miles, making it easy to track your progress over time.

Practical Example
Let’s say you walked 7,500 steps today, and your stride length is 2.5 feet.
- Enter
7500in the steps field. - Enter
2.5for stride length. - Choose
3 decimal placesfor precision. - Click Calculate Miles.
The calculator will display: Miles=7500×2.55280≈3.551 miles\text{Miles} = \frac{7500 \times 2.5}{5280} \approx 3.551 \text{ miles}Miles=52807500×2.5≈3.551 miles
This instant conversion helps you track your walking goals without guesswork.

Tips for Accurate Results
- Measure your stride length carefully for the best accuracy.
- Adults generally have strides between 2.2 to 2.5 feet; children’s strides are shorter.

2. How do I calculate miles from steps manually?
Multiply steps by stride length in feet and divide by 5,280 (feet in a mile).
3. Can I use this calculator for running steps?
Yes, just enter your running stride length for accurate distance conversion.
4. What is an average adult stride length?
Typically, it’s between 2.2 to 2.5 feet.
